RETL vs. XYZG
RETL (Direxion Daily Retail Bull 3X Shares) and XYZG (Leverage Shares 2X Long XYZ Daily ETF) are both Leveraged Equities funds. RETL is passively managed, while XYZG is actively managed. Over the past year, RETL returned 11.63% vs -10.69% for XYZG. A 0.53 correlation means they provide meaningful diversification when combined. RETL charges 0.99%/yr vs 0.75%/yr for XYZG.
